Note: Stacks of Charged with Light may still be consumed when used against Combatant even when it is not the highest Modifier %! When Weapons of Light expires, Well of Radiance - assuming it is still active - takes over as the highest active Modifier %.Well's uber health regeneration effect will still work as normal (this is why so many Fireteams combo both Bubble for buffs + Well for health regen).Ward of Dawn's Weapons of Light will take priority as it is the highest % || High-Energy Fire & Well of Radiance's empowering effects do NOT stack and have lower %s.a Well of Radiance (25%), a Ward of Dawn (35%), stacks of High-Energy Fire (20% via Charged with Light) are all active together.

Reminder: Charged with Light, Aeon Cult, and some specific Seasonal Artifact Mods (if applicable for the current Season listed below if they are) DO NOT STACK with Empowering Buffs or themselves!.If a high Modifier % duration elapses, then the next highest active Modifier % will take priority.
